Description
'Security Brand Malathion Multi-purpose Spray' is an insecticide and miticide. Its Federal EPA registration number is: 270-291. It was originally approved by EPA on 05 Jan 1987. Its registration got cancelled on 25 Aug 2000. It has a 'Caution' signal word. It has the following active ingredients: Malathion (NO INERT USE). It's approved for 78 sites including apricots, avocados, beans, beets, blackberries, blackeyed peas, blueberries, boysenberries, brambles, and broccoli. It is also approved for 82 pests and pest groups including but not limited to aphids, armyworm, asparagus aphid, asparagus beetle, azalea scale, bagworm, birch leafminer, black scale, blueberry maggot, and boxwood leafminer.
